People have been speculating about who might have aided and abetted Bernard Madoff in his Ponzi scheme. The spotlight now turns to his brother, Peter Madoff. A New York Times reporter has been shown redemption checks made out to clients of the Madoff advisory business that were signed not be Bernie, but by Peter. These were checks signed in 1985.

Prosecutors say in court filings that the scheme dates "at least to the 1980s," although they have not made public any evidence to that end. So it's unclear what degree of complicity this suggests. Bernie has said that the scheme began in the 1990s. In any case, in a separate matter, a Nassau County judge has frozen Peter Madoff's assets in response to a suit by the beneficiary of a victimized trust.
